原文:Python+Xlwings操作Excel刪除行和列

一 需求: 某公司管理的多個資管計划每天生成A表,業務人員需手工打開每個A表,將某些行 列刪除后方可打印上報。 現擬采用程序代替手工操作。 二 分析: 應在原始文件的副本上操作,因此需拷貝文件夾內所有Excel至目標目錄 解答:使用shutil.copy 需打開excel並刪除指定的行和列 解答:openpyxl不支持xls格式,xlwt無法刪除行和列,最終選擇xlwings 三 代碼實現: us ...

2020-01-13 13:23 0 7209 推薦指數:

查看詳情

python利用xlwings寫入一或一Excel數據

注意點:這里的sheet參數默認是已經存在的sheet表,如不存在該sheet,則使用add方法新增即可,示例: 寫入列 一次寫一 import xlwings as xw def write_col(io, sheet, col='A1', data=None ...

Sun Jun 28 19:09:00 CST 2020 0 4117
Python學習筆記:pd.drop刪除行

一、介紹 通過指定標簽名稱和相應的軸,或直接指定索引或列名稱,刪除行。 使用多索引時,可以通過指定級別來刪除不同級別上的標簽。 使用語法: 參數解釋: 二、實操 刪除簡單索引 多重索引刪除數據 參考鏈接:Python中pandas ...

Thu Oct 21 17:32:00 CST 2021 0 7842
VBA EXCEL刪除行的方法

'Option Explicit'Const sheetName As String = "電腦中心"Private Sub CommandButton1_Click()ActiveCell.Ent ...

Sun May 24 04:55:00 CST 2020 0 579
利用poi開源jar包操作Excel刪除行內容與直接刪除行的區別

一般情況下,刪除行時會面臨兩種情況:刪除行內容但保留位置、整行刪除刪除后下方單元格上移)。對應的刪除方法分別是: 示例代碼: 以下代碼是使用removeRow()方法刪除行內容但保留位置。代碼從d:\test.xls中的第一個sheet中刪除了第一。需要 ...

Thu Aug 18 22:34:00 CST 2016 0 4477
DataGridView使用技巧四:刪除行操作

一、無條件的刪除行 默認時,DataGridView是允許用戶進行行的刪除操作,選中要刪除,按Delete鍵可以刪除,該操作沒有任何提示(只是刪除界面顯示的數據,不會真實刪除數據庫中的數據)。如果設置DataGridView對象的AllowUserToDeleteRows屬性為False ...

Sun Apr 23 06:34:00 CST 2017 0 3937
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M